At the risk of re-opening a can of worms....

Do not be quick to discount the implications of these verses and to think they are not applicable for today. It is true that in God's kingdom there are no second class citizens, but it is just too easy to dismiss this by saying, "Well, this is only applicable for the Corinthian church," or "This was just a problem for uneducated women," or "This was only a cultural phenomenon of the time and doesn't apply today."

The previous explanations not withstanding, it is a scary thing to me to dismiss this command as not being applicable for our time when in the very next section the Word of God says, "If you claim to be a prophet or think you are very spiritual, you should recognize that what I am saying is a command from the Lord himself" (I Cor 14:37). The warnings don't get much stronger that that!

Please be very careful. Just because it is not our current cultural practice, shouldn't we conform ourselves to the Word of God instead of the culture? If you start dismissing certain passages of Scripture as not being culturally relevant today, what is to prevent me from saying that prohibitions against gossip or fornication are not culturally relevant? After all, "Everyone is doing it." Let's really think about this.

As for not interpreting this literally, how could it possibly be interpreted except literally? The over-riding principle of biblical interpretation is to take Scripture at its face value and that the plain meaning takes precedence. This is not an unclear passage. We do not need to perform hermenutical gymnastics with the text. What is it about "Women should be silent..." that is too hard to understand?

Just because "There is neither... male nor female..." in terms of our salvation and standing in Christ (as per Galatians 3:21) that does not mean there is not an order, a hierarchy, a division of labor and gender roles in God's household (1 Cor 15:40). Men and women were created differently for different roles. Even though all the members of the Trinity are completely equal and all equally God, there is still a hierarchy, an order, and different roles in the Godhead (1 Cor 15:26-28). If this is true in the Trinity, should we be surprised that God has also mandated this in His church?

Now, a practical problem... When women begin speaking in church, exerting authority, teaching men, or taking leadership over men in the church, what happens? The men leave and the women and children are left to wonder, "What happened to all the men? Why are they spiritually checked out?" We can all say, "It shouldn't be that way!" but that's the way it works: God designed men to lead. So men, step up!

I don't have the easy answers for this. All I'm advocating is that we think and pray about this. Let's not be quick to toss these verses over the side thinking that we somehow know better, are more spiritual, or more enlightened today. That was exactly the arrogance God was warning the Corinthian believers against in 1 Corinthians 14: 36-38.
